Transaction 91e61f2f40c652ec79d385667d45ac86b359ff4dafb8a6dee20fb44ae7cc6176

1 Input
2 Outputs
  • 91e61f2f40c652ec79d385667d45ac86b359ff4dafb8a6dee20fb44ae7cc6176:0
  • value  3644207
    address  15i1KkrjbF1zxneW33h3SopGQwstVMeaRS
  • 91e61f2f40c652ec79d385667d45ac86b359ff4dafb8a6dee20fb44ae7cc6176:1
  • value  29057279
    address  13ryq3BNDUGvwpt1oMdMqLvC1ukRBqfw9t